Descriptions of the Nymphs of Eastern North American Species of Cultus (Plecoptera: Perlodidae)

Myers LW and Kondratieff BC. 2009. Descriptions of the Nymphs of Eastern North American Species of Cultus (Plecoptera: Perlodidae). Entomologica Americana. 115(2):109-114

The nymphs of eastern North American stonefly genus Cultus are described. Previous misidentifications and putative nymphal descriptions are reviewed. A key separating the late instar nymphs is also provided.
